Service description

The Health Innovation Zone is a specialised pre-validation programme designed to accelerate the market readiness of HealthTech startups. This programme is uniquely crafted to support innovators developing digital health solutions, medical devices, and AI-driven healthcare applications. It addresses the critical needs of early-stage startups by providing a comprehensive pathway from concept validation to regulatory compliance. The programme runs for 6 months and includes three key phases: 1) Pre-Validation & Mentoring: Startups receive tailored mentorship from healthcare experts and regulatory advisors, focusing on product validation, clinical requirements, and go-to-market strategy. 2) Pilot & Use Case Testing: Participants gain exclusive access to pilot environments within our network of medical institutions and Living Labs, enabling real-world testing and feedback from end-users and healthcare professionals. 3) Market Access & Networking: The programme culminates in a Demo Day where startups present their validated solutions to investors, healthcare stakeholders, and strategic partners. Matchmaking sessions facilitate partnerships and international scaling opportunities. Targeted at HealthTech startups at TRL 4-7, the programme is ideal for innovators looking to validate their solutions in real healthcare settings and accelerate regulatory approval. Expected outcomes include validated product-market fit, clinical readiness, and strategic partnerships for scaling. Mode of implementation is hybrid, combining in-person pilot testing and online mentoring sessions. Health Innovation Zone is the only programme in Romania offering structured pre-validation and direct access to pilot use cases (such as public hospitals), making it a vital launchpad for HealthTech innovation.

Financial requirements

The mentoring and coaching sessions are offered free of charge. 
The pilot testing and access to healthcare institutions is charged at a fee of €1000 per institution, including multiple meetings, iterations, solution testing and medical users feedback collecting.

Disclaimer related to service

The cohort starts each year in June, late registration is possible for the EIC beneficiaries until August.
